Choosing between direct and connecting flights from Antalya Airport (AYT) affects price, travel time and comfort. Direct flights are faster but usually pricier in business class, while connecting itineraries (commonly via Istanbul, Doha or Dubai) often deliver the cheapest business-class arrivals due to competition among carriers and more inventory options.

Flight times from Antalya Airport (AYT) vary by destination and routing. Typical non-stop or one-stop durations: Antalya to Istanbul (IST) ~1 hour 10 minutes direct; Antalya to London (LHR) ~4 hours direct (seasonal charters/one-stop options); Antalya to Frankfurt (FRA) ~3 hours direct; Antalya to Dubai (DXB) ~4 hours direct (seasonal). Many long-haul business-class itineraries will include a connection at Istanbul, Doha, or a major European hub; total travel time depends on layover length.
